Mamutik or Manukan Island Day Trip
Book this tour.
Just 15 minutes boat ride from Kota Kinabalu, are the beautiful coral islands of the Tunku Abdul Rahman Park. Offering pristine white beaches, clear water and coral reefs, this is the perfect getaway from the town. After collection from your hotel, take a short boat ride to Manutik or Manukan islands for a day of relaxation and swimming. Mask and snorkel are provided. Basic washroom facilities are available on the island. Enjoy lunch on the island. Return to Kota Kinabalu mid-afternoon.
Hotel pick-up & boat transfers and lunch.
This tour does not include a guide. A park entrance fee of RM 10.60 per person is payable upon arrival at the island.

Manukan Island
- The Manukan is the most popular island among travellers to Kota Kinabalu since it is easily accessible from the Kota Kinabalu jetty.
- This boomerang shaped island is also the second largest in the Tun Abdul Rahman marine park .
- With turquoise colored water, and a wide range of water activities, the Manukan is perfect for water activities, swimming and snorkeling.
- For most day tour package, the Manukan is the place to savour lunch during the island trip.
Sapi Island
- If Manukan island is famous for the view, the Sapi island is famous for the amount of marine lives swimming in its water.
- Once here, try spot clownfish while you snorkel.
- If money is not a problem, try Sea Walking – a new way to explore the ocean without needing you to learn scuba diving.
- Those wanting to go across the ocean in style can also try ziplining across the 2 borneo islands.

Manukan Island is the second largest island in the Tunku Abdul Rahman National Park. Manukan Island has some good stretches of beaches on the southern coastline. The best beach is on the eastern tip of the island. Offshore of Manukan are coral reefs, which is ideal for snorkelling, diving and swimming. Out of the five islands making up Tunku Abdul Rahman National Park, Manukan Island features the most developed tourist facilities that includes 20 units of chalets, a clubhouse, and few restaurants and a diving centre. Recreation facilities include a swimming pool, football field, Volleyball and Sepak Takraw courts. Infrastructural facilities include support-water, electricity, desalination plant, sewerage system, and even a solar public telephone. It is covered in dense vegetation and has hiking trails.
Sapi Island is one of the most popular places in Sabah to swim, snorkel and relax and it is just 20 minutes boat ride away from Kota Kinabalu. The moment one arrives at the jetty, crystal clear water of the sea with school of fish numbering in thousand can be seen swimming around the jetty. Among them are Napoleon fish and Parrot fish.
After passing through the park entrance, most visitors will head off to the short white sandy beach which stretches from the jetty to the western rocky cliff. Wooden tables and seats are provided put there are not many, some visitors might have to use floor mate to settle down their belongings. Manukan Island, a tropical paradise
For the last part of our Bornean adventure , we chose to spend our time in a tropical paradise: Manukan Island. This is the type of island you see on Instagram pictures and think it is too awesome to be real: a tiny island covered by lush green jungle, surrounded by white sand beaches and blue, crystal clear waters. It was the perfect end of our wonderful time in Borneo and a very welcoming island retreat after our mountain escape at Kinabalu Park .
Manukan Island
Manukan Island is part of Tunku Abdul Rahman National Park, Malaysia’s first marine national park. The second largest island in the park, it is the most popular one among Kota Kinabalu locals. It also has the best touristic infrastructure among the 5 islands.
Unfortunately, the tropical paradise is flooded each day by hundreds of visitors, from around 10 in the morning until 4 in the afternoon. Just 15-20 minutes away from Kota Kinabalu, a day trip to Manukan Island is a very popular activity both for tourists that want to see the beautiful beaches and for locals that chose to spend their weekends away from the city. There are lots of boats departing to Manukan from Jesselton Point in Kota Kinabalu. Luckily, the last public boat leaves the island at 4 PM, leaving it quiet and tranquil again. What to do on Manukan Island
While on Manukan Island, there are plenty activities to be done if you get bored of lying on the beach. Sutera Sanctuary Lodges has sport fields available and various water sports can be practiced nearby. The staff can also assist to arrange trips to other islands in Tunku Abdul Rahman Park.
Near the beach you can try snorkelling. The reef if quite close to the shore and South China Sea hosts a large variety of fishes. If you want to experience more marine wildlife, TARP includes over 25 diving sites and underwater visibility is generally 10-15m.
If you spend the night on the island, do not miss the sunset point. It is located just 20-30 minutes away from the reception, on an easy, paved trail. The views are spectacular, for me there’s no better sunset than on a tiny island! Just make sure you take mosquito repellent and a torch or a flashlight with you. It will be dark by the time you get back to the resort.

Manukan Island, the Most Popular Island of Sabah
With over 200,000 visits annually, Manukan (Pulau Manukan) is the most frequented island by domestic and international tourists . It is only 15-minute away by boat ride, almost a no-brainer choice for people who want an island day trip near to Kota Kinabalu City (KK).
Factor #1. Manukan has long stretch of white sandy beach
Its long beach spans about 1,500 Meter at southern side of the island, facing a bay of crystal clear and tranquil sea. The water is so calm and shallow that it’s also suitable for non-swimmers. Families feel safe to let their kids playing in the water. No matter how far their children go, parents still can have a clear open view on what’s going on.
Factor #2. Manukan has the Most Developed Facilities
Tourists can find almost everything they need there, from toilet, shower room, restaurants, water sport activities, souvenir shop to accommodation. You can go to Manukan empty-handed (must bring cash!) and buy your things such as food, sunscreen and beachwear on the island. But please be informed nothing is cheap on the island.
Factor #3. Manukan Island has the Best Snorkelling Spot
Among the five islands of TARP, Manukan Island ranks top as a snorkelling site. Though its coral reef is not of world class, it’s still a wonderful treat to nature lovers. Sighting of Nemo is guaranteed. You can even see Nemo from the jetty, with thousands of other fishes.

Entrance Fee
You need to purchase ticket (which they call Conservation Fee) to enter the island. The table below is the ticket rates. Don’t forget to add return boat transfer and terminal fee (about RM30 in total, ≈US$9) to your travel budget.
*Rates updated in Jan 2023. The entry is free for visitor with disability.
You can have fun with many water sports on Manukan Island. The most popular and recommended activity on Manukan is Snorkelling. You can rent the snorkelling gears easily on Manukan or boat terminal on mainland. It’s ok if you don’t know how to swim, just wear a life jacket.
Below is a list of activities and prices just FYI. Get extra cash ready if you plan to play these:
Tip: These are just Listed Prices . No harm to haggle.
Ladies, be careful when some “friendly” locals approach you and offer “snorkelling tour.” There were cases these so-called guides took their female guests to deeper water, making them panic, then took the opportunity to molest them. Just report to the police on the island if that happens.
Manukan Island Resort
You can overnight on Manukan Island if you love it so much. Manukan Island Resort is the only accommodation on Manukan and they have about 20 units of single and double storey chalets. The accommodation fees* range from RM560 (≈US$170) per room to RM1,500 (≈US$450) per chalet. You may look at their online booking page for room details and updated prices . *full board package which includes accommodation, meals, island entrance fee and boat transfer
There are two types of villa, i.e. Hill Side Chalet and Beach Chalet. Hill Side Chalets have sea view but Beach Chalets don’t. FYI, camping is not allowed on Manukan Island.
For reservation, you may book the room online or contact Sutera Sanctuary Lodges (management of the resort) at: Website: www.suterasanctuarylodges.com.my E-mail: [email protected] Phone: +60 88-308914 , +60 88-308915 , +60 88-308916 Cellphone: +60 17-8335022 They also have a reservation center for walk-in guests (opposite to reception / ticket counter of Manukan).
Restaurants
Food and drink are readily available on Manukan Island but sold at “tourist price”. If you are price-conscious, I would advise you to bring your own food. Barbecue (BBQ) is forbidden on Manukan (some outdated websites say you can BBQ on the island).
Perahu Restaurant is the most established restaurant on Manukan Island. You can dine in their air-conditioning room. Sometimes they close for group function. They open from 11:30am to 4pm. Other Facilities
Besides, there are football and volleyball fields in the center of island. For Muslims, Surau (prayer room) is available too. I wish they have locker service so I can store my belonging because I can’t bring my wallet to snorkelling. Without locker, life will be a bit difficult for solo traveler to Manukan.
Sunset Point
If you like jungle and have time to spare, you may go to Sunset Point in western edge of Manukan Island. Day trip tourists have to leave the island before 5pm so most of them don’t bother to walk 1.5 KM to Sunset Point that has no sunset. I’m not sure whether that can motivate them, if I tell them two rare mangrove trees, which are critically endangered and only 200 of them left in the wild, are found at Sunset Point.
Finally I saw the rare mangrove trees. They are locally known as Berus Mata Buaya (means “Eye of the Crocodile”). Its scientific name is Bruguiera hainesii , and only about 200 of them left in the world (mainly in Indonesia and Malaysia). I’m so happy that we have two on Manukan. I have no idea how they got here. These two trees look like a couple. Perhaps they purposely chose this sunset viewpoint as their landing spot? So romantic. There are two seedlings growing next to them. Seem like they are starting a family. Not only that, both trees were flowering and fruiting during my visit. Singaporean plant scientist Prof Dr Jean Yong said, “having the tree here is equivalent to China having pandas.” I got close-up video of these trees if you want to see more.
Overall, Manukan Island is a wonderful destination. I recommend it to tourists who don’t want to travel far to our east coast for island trip.
How to get there
Manukan Island ( see Location Map ) is a public marine park which accepts walk-in tourists. You don’t need to apply a permit or book any tour package to go to Manukan Island. Return boat transfer to Manukan is readily available from 8am to 4pm at any one of the boat terminals in KK City . Please note the last boat returning to KK City departs at 4pm or 4:30pm (unless you stay in resort).
